Everybody Into the Hotel Pool! That’ll Be $200.

Some hotels now charge swimmers and sunbathers to reserve a basic poolside lounge chair, often with few other perks

The main pool at the Bellagio resort in Las Vegas, where guests can pay to reserve chairs. MGM RESORTS INTERNATIONAL
Dawn Gilbertson

Hotels have long tacked pesky fees to guest bills. Mandatory nightly resort fees that can top $50 with tax. Valet and self-parking charges. Plus fees for early check-in, late checkout, rollaway beds and mini fridges.

Now they’re coming for the lounge chair.
